Send data from file even if there is no change

shreyasathavale
Communicator

I have a file in a directory, whose timestamp is changed everyday using "touch" command. The contents might change after 3 months but not daily.
I need to monitor this file in splunk and read the contents even if they are same.

Tags (1)
0 Karma
1 Solution

manjunathmeti
Champion

In props.conf set CHECK_METHOD = modtime for the source to check the modification time of the file.

props.conf

 [source::<file_path>]
 CHECK_METHOD = modtime

manjunathmeti
Champion

CHECK_METHOD = modtime must be set for [source:] stanza only not sourcetype.

Add this to props.conf.

[source::D:\splunk\abc.csv]
CHECK_METHOD = modtime
